2022 Volkswagen Golf GTI Trailer Wiring Harness Recommendation
Question:
Hello, I’m looking for the trailer wire harness for a 2022 Volkswagen GTI. Would you have this? Thanks
asked by: Ramiro R
Expert Reply:
Hey Ramiro, thanks for reaching out!
I recommend using the ZCI Circuit Protected Vehicle Wiring Harness # 119250KIT for your 2022 Volkswagen Golf GTI because it's powered by your vehicle battery and it uses clamps to sense when to send signals to the trailer lights.
At this point in time there aren't any custom-fit harnesses for your vehicle so a universal fit like this is what you'll need to use.
The instructions for this wiring kit can be a little intimidating but if you're into DIY projects then you'll bed able to figure it out. If this is your first time installing wiring then I recommend having a shop tackle this for you.
